Based on our analysis of NIST CSF 2.0 coverage, core features, integrations, company size fit, here is our conclusion:
Mid-market and enterprise teams facing ransomware threats need FortKnox because its air-gapped virtual vault makes encrypted backups genuinely unreachable during active attacks, not just theoretically so. The immutable snapshots with retention locks address NIST PR.DS and RC.RP functions that most backup tools treat as afterthoughts, while integrated threat scanning before restore prevents you from recovering compromised data. Skip this if your organization can tolerate a longer recovery window; the isolation model trades some restore speed for the certainty that your backup tier stays isolated even when production infrastructure is already encrypted.
Tata Communications Vayu Cloud Storage
Enterprise teams managing large SAP or Oracle deployments will get the most from Tata Communications Vayu Cloud Storage because its Data Capsule device lets you physically transfer up to 100TB before syncing to cloud, avoiding bandwidth throttling on initial migrations. The tool covers all four NIST CSF 2.0 domains we tested, including both data security and incident recovery execution, which is uncommon in backup-focused offerings. Skip this if your primary need is ransomware detection or real-time threat response; Vayu prioritizes archival durability and collaboration over active threat hunting.

Cohesity FortKnox integrates with AWS, Azure, GCP, Cohesity DataProtect, NetBackup. Tata Communications Vayu Cloud Storage integrates with SAP, Oracle. Check integration compatibility with your existing security stack before deciding.
